Anna Ivers returns home to her sister Alex (Arielle Kebbel) after a stint in a mental hospital, though her recovery is jeopardized thanks to her cruel stepmother (Elizabeth Banks). Her dismay quickly turns to horror when she is visited by ghastly visions of her dead mother. I'm always hesitant to watch horror movies on Netflix, because they tend to be newer and lower budget (not that this is always a bad thing). This one is newer, but the budget is there, and they were able to get a few faces I recognize. Especially Arielle Kebbel and Elizabeth Banks, with a nice, smaller role by horror veteran Jesse Moss. Much of the film plays out sort of like a mystery. What is going on? Is it supernatural? Is the stepmother really who she claims to be? It's not the best suspense film, but it is more than adequate in holding your attention, especially thanks to strong performances. In a way, this film anticipates the widely celebrated "Goodnight Mommy".

It's always wonderful when a commercial studio picture can broadside you like "The Uninvited" does. Never having seen the Japanese original, I went into this blindly and quickly became engrossed in the plot. It seemed straightforward enough and the acting was exceptional. Emily Browning and Elizabeth Banks play their roles seamlessly and the storyline, though incorporating a number of supernatural elements, never feels kitschy or hackneyed. There's no reason you wouldn't take them at face value. When the trip cable pops up at the end and everything turns bizarroville, the credibility still holds up. It's a tight story and tight piece of drama....way better than it has the right to be considering it's budget and genre.
